My product is something that I can exhibit at a wedding fair in Cork in Jan but I would like some advise re is it worth it to Exhibit or should I target marketing another way - Cost of stand for two days is up to €800 - I work alone so this is a big cost for one man show.

Any advice greatly appreciated. - As product is made to order there is no selling on the day.
 
Do you think you'll get at least €800 in profit as a direct result of the stand? (consider as well how good is your product in word-of-mouth sales)

Work it out
- how many orders will you need to get?
- How many potential customers will be visiting?
- How good are you (or whoever will be on the stand) at getting orders?

What alternative marketing strategies have you considered?

I did a similiar analysis for a product I was selling and decided against a stand.
 
Also take into account you will be required to have Public Liability insurance for your stand which will be an additional cost if you don't already have a policy in force.
